Frequently Asked Questions
Is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h) safe for people with kidney disease?
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h) is rated Safe for CKD patients. Good choice for kidney disease patients. With 27.0mg phosphorus, 157.0mg sodium, and 222.0mg potassium per 100.0g serving, it can be enjoyed in normal portion sizes. Always confirm with your nephrologist or renal dietitian.
How much phosphorus is in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h)?
A 100.0g serving of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h) contains 27mg of phosphorus, which is approximately 3% of the recommended 1,000mg daily limit for CKD Stage 3-4 patients.
How much sodium is in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h)?
Per 100.0g serving,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h) provides 157mg of sodium — about 7% of the 2,300mg daily sodium limit recommended for kidney patients.
How much potassium is in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h)?
Collards, Cooked With Butter Or Margarine (Fresh) contains 222mg of potassium per 100.0g serving, equivalent to about 11% of the daily 2,000mg potassium limit for CKD Stage 3-4 patients.
